三角尖端r角怎么编程

时间:2025-03-04 20:26:21 明星趣事

在数控编程中,定义R角(即圆弧的半径)通常使用G代码和M代码的结合。以下是几种常见的编程方法:

使用G01、G02、G03指令

G01:用于指定直线切削进给,其中R参数表示内半径。

G02:用于指定顺时针圆弧切削进给,其中R参数表示内半径。

G03:用于指定逆时针圆弧切削进给,其中R参数表示内半径。

使用I、J、K参数

在G02和G03指令中,I和J参数分别表示圆心在当前坐标系下X轴和Y轴的偏移量,R参数表示以当前切削点为起点,绘制一个半径为R的圆弧。

使用刀具半径补偿

在编写R角程序时,需要设置刀具半径补偿,以确保加工的精度。例如,在三菱加工中心中,可以通过在对应的刀具半径参数R后面输入需要的R角尺寸值,并在G40/G41/G42加工模式下进行编程。

使用UG软件编程

UG软件提供了图形化编程功能,可以通过绘制轨迹、设置运动路径来实现复杂的运动和操作。此外,UG还支持用户自定义宏的编写和调用,以及编程辅助工具如CAM模块、特征识别等,这些工具可以自动识别几何特征和刀具路径,并生成相应的编程代码。

示例代码

假设要编程一个逆时针方向的R角,起点坐标为(X1, Y1),终点坐标为(X2, Y2),R角半径为R,可以使用以下代码:

```plaintext

G02 X2 Y2 R1

```

其中,X2和Y2表示圆弧的终点坐标,R1表示R角的半径。

建议

在实际编程过程中,建议参考机床的操作手册和控制系统的编程指南来编写正确的代码。

对于复杂的几何形状或特殊的运动需求,可以考虑使用图形化编程或用户宏编程来提高编程效率和精度。

在编写程序后,务必进行模拟运行和调试,以确保程序的正确性和加工精度。